Pakistan is a country with a rich cultural heritage, and its diverse regions are home to a wide range of traditional dances. In the Pashtun community, which is predominantly found in the northwestern region of Pakistan, dance plays an important role in their cultural and social gatherings. Pashto dance, also known as "Attan," is a traditional folk dance that is performed by both men and women on special occasions such as weddings, festivals, and celebrations.

In the context of Pakistani relationships, dance often serves as a safe medium for romantic expression. In a society where overt public displays of affection (PDA) are often discouraged, synchronized dances between couples or "flirty" solo performances directed at a fiancé serve as a modern courtship ritual. In Pakistan, dance has always been the heartbeat of weddings. For decades, the "Mehndi dance" was a private affair where girls practiced for weeks to perform choreographed routines to Bollywood and Lollywood hits. In recent years, the intersection of traditional folk music and contemporary entertainment has evolved. Modern Pashto music videos and regional film performances often incorporate faster, more stylized choreography, blending traditional steps with modern flair. These performances are popular in local entertainment circles and on social media platforms, showcasing a blend of traditional culture and modern aesthetics.
